Car lights on the Catalina Highway (also known as the General Hitchcock Highway) snake toward the lights of Tucson, Arizona as the last glow of twilight remains. Seen from Windy Point Vista. Thimble Peak in the Santa Catalina Mountains can be seen in the foreground ,and the Quinlan Mountains and Tucson Mountains can be seen off in the distance.
The Windy Point Vista offers one of the best scenic views of Tucson and is a great stop along the ascent of Mount Lemmon north of the City. The streak of headlights winding through the canyon is formed by a long exposure photograph.
Tucson based photographer and artist Chance Kafka is a native of Laramie, Wyoming, and grew up in the small community of Wheatland, before returning to Laramie for college. He took an interest into photography at a young age, photographing clouds, sunsets, and landscapes. At age 17, he won 1st Place in the Platte County Fair photography competition in 3 out of 5 categories as the only entrant to win more than one category. Following this local success, he worked as a feature writer and photographer for the Platte County Record Times while still in high school.
